Zemire und Azor

Opera by Spohr (libretto by J J Ihlee, based on that by Marmontel), produced in Frankfurt on 4 April 1819. The familiar song ‘Rose, softly blooming’ is in this work. For a plot synopsis, see Zémire et Azore.
